1. Traditional Full-Hand Bridal Mehndi Design
Despite all the new trends, traditional mehndi still holds a special place.
What Makes It Popular:
- Dense, intricate patterns
- Covers hands and feet completely
- Includes motifs like peacocks, paisleys, and mandalas
These designs are known for their richness and cultural significance. They often take hours to apply but create a stunning, royal look.
Best for: Brides who want a grand, classic wedding look
2. Arabic Bridal Mehndi Design
Arabic mehndi has become a favorite for modern brides who prefer elegance with simplicity.
Key Features:
- Bold outlines
- Floral trails and vines
- Less filling, more spacing
This style is quicker to apply and gives a stylish, contemporary vibe without looking too heavy.
Best for: Brides who want something modern yet traditional

7. Negative Space Mehndi Design
This is one of the most visually striking trends right now.
What Makes It Unique:
- Uses empty spaces creatively
- Highlights patterns instead of filling everything
- Looks modern and artistic
Negative space designs create a clean, high-fashion look that stands out in photos.
8. Jewelry-Style Mehndi Design
Inspired by bridal jewelry, this trend is gaining popularity fast.
Includes:
- Bracelet (kada) patterns
- Ring-chain (haath phool) designs
- Anklet-style mehndi
It gives the illusion of wearing jewelry, making your hands look elegant even without accessories.

How to Choose the Right Bridal Mehndi Design
With so many options, choosing the right one can feel confusing. Here’s a simple way to decide:
Match Your Outfit
- Heavy lehenga → Traditional or detailed designs
- Light outfit → Minimal or Arabic designs
Consider Your Wedding Theme
- Royal wedding → Full traditional mehndi
- Beach wedding → Minimal or floral styles
- Modern wedding → Fusion or negative space
Think About Time & Comfort
If you don’t want to sit for long hours, avoid extremely intricate designs.
Choose the Right Artist
A skilled mehndi artist can customize any design to suit your hands and style.
